欢迎来到天天文库
浏览记录
ID:50689640
大小:80.00 KB
页数:7页
时间:2020-03-13
《JAVA程序设计A卷试卷修改版.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、装订线华南农业大学期末考试试卷(A卷)2011-2012学年第1学期 考试科目:Java程序设计考试类型:(闭卷)考试 考试时间: 120 分钟学号姓名年级专业题号一二三总分得分评阅人考试说明:所有答案必须填写在答卷上,考试结束时答卷和试卷都上交。得分一、单项选择题(本大题共25小题,每小题2分,共50分)1.下列有关Java程序的说法中正确的是____B____:A.由于Java程序是解释执行的,所以执行前不需要进行编译B.一个.java源程序编译后将产生一个.class的字节码文件C.安装了JDK后,安装程序会自动配置系统的环境变量pat
2、h和classpathD.面向对象的解释型高级编程语言2.下列为合法变量名的是____C____。A.falseB.0xabcC.iStudentD.cow’s3.对于构造方法,下列叙述不正确的是____C____。A.构造方法是类的一种特殊方法,它的方法名必须与类名相同B.构造方法没有返回值类型C.子类不但可以继承父类的无参构造方法,也可以继承父类的有参构造方法。D.子类在创建构造方法是必须把调用父类构造方法放在第一条语句4.下列关于接口的说明正确的是____D____。A.接口和抽象类是同一回事B.一个类不可以实现多个接口C.接口间不能有继承
3、关系D.实现一个接口必须实现接口的所有方法5.Java为移动设备提供的平台是____A____。A.J2ME B.J2SE C.J2EE D.JDK5.06.下列语句中,属于多分支语句的是____B____。A.if语句 B.switch语句 C.dowhile语句 D.for语句7装订线1.在Java中,存放字符串常量的对象属于____B____类对象。A.CharacterB.StringC.StringBufferD.Char2.下列关于继承的哪项叙述是正确____D____。A.在java中允许多继承B.在java中一个类只能实现一个接口
4、C.在java中一个类不能同时继承一个类和实现一个接口D.java的单一继承使代码更可靠3.给出如下代码:CclassTest{ privateintm; publicstaticvoidfun(){//somecode...}}如何使成员变量m被函数fun()直接访问?A.将privateintm改为protectedintmB.将privateintm改为publicintmC.将privateintm改为staticintmD.将privateintm改为intm4.System和Math类在哪个包中___C_____。A.java.i
5、oB.java.langC.java.awtD.java.util5.能从循环语句的循环体中跳出的语句是___B_____。A.for语句B.break语句C.while语句D.continue语句6.若类中某方法进行重载,能够区分这重载方法的手段是__C______。A.它们的返回值类型的不同B.它们的名称的不同C.它们的参数表的不同D.它们的修饰符不同7.下列关于for循环和while循环的说法中哪个是正确的____A____。A.while循环能实现的操作,for循环也都能实现 B.while循环判断条件一般是程序结果,for循环判断条件
6、一般是非程序结果 C.两种循环任何时候都可替换 D.两种循环结构中都必须有循环体,循环体不能为空8.下列关于main()方法说法正确的是___A_____。A.public修饰类中可以没有main()方法;B.main()方法中主要完成所有对象的创建;C.public修饰的类有多个时,main()方法就有多个;D.main()方法头的定义可以根据情况随意修改。9.以下数据类型定义正确的是____D____。A.booleanb=0;B.chars=‘t’;C.byteb=-268;D.floatf=2.5e3.10.在一个应用程序中有如下定
7、义:inta[]={1,2,3,4,5,6,7,8,9,10};为了打印输出数组a的最后一个元素,下面正确的代码是___B_____。A.System.out.println(a[10]);B.System.out.println(a[9]);C.System.out.println(a[a.length]);D.System.out.println(a(9));7装订线1.定义二维数组a,不正确的是___C_____。A.int[][]a;B.inta[][];C.int[]a[];D.int[3][3]a;2.下列关于抽象类的说法哪个正确__
8、B______。A.绝对不能用抽象类去创建对象;B.某个抽象类的父类是抽象类,则这个子类必须重载父类的所有抽象方法;C.抽象类中不可以有
此文档下载收益归作者所有